Women's 2nd Xl finish season with narrow defeat

20 Aug 2017

On Thursday evening, Malahide Women's 2nd Xl welcomed Leinster for the final match of the season. Malahide fielded first and the opening bowlers of Aisling (1-12) and Isobel (1-19) bowled brilliantly and made Leinster work hard for their runs. Malahide fielded really well with great wicket keeping from Gemma and  catches from Maria & Tess. Sarah (1-23) and Beth (1-4) took wickets while Juliette, Katie, Maria and Tess all bowled well, keeping the Leinster total down to 94 for 4 from their 20 overs. 

Malahide started their chase well with Isobel (6) and Aisling (1) opening the batting. Sarah (16) hit the ball really well as did Tess (14). With 3 wickets down Karen (7) joined Tess and they formed a good partnership together of 30 runs.  Unfortunately, Leinster got a few quick wickets as the match was becoming close. Some good running from Gemma (7*), Sofia (2) and Beth (2) kept the Malahide total going. Gemma and Juliette fought hard at the end of the innings but unfortunately, Malahide ended up 4 runs short at 90 for 4 from their 20 overs. 

This was a great Team effort from Malahide and very fitting for the last match of the season.
